Основная функциональность Snoop Project — выслеживать «username» в публичных данных, дополнительно присутствуют различные OSINT-плагины.
Snoop Project внесён в реестр отечественного ПО РФ с заявленным кодом 26.30.11.16: Программное Обеспечение, обеспечивающее выполнение установленных действий при проведении оперативно-розыскных мероприятий: №7012 приказ 07.10.2020 №515.
Snoop Project разработан на материалах исследовательской работы в области скрапинга публичных данных (собственная БД). На данный момент Snoop выслеживает nickname по 3.7K интернет-ресурсам (в полной версии) и по самым популярным ресурсам (в демо-версии).
Подготовлены готовые сборки для OS GNU/Linux и Windows, из исходников собирается и в Termux (Android) https://github.com/snooppr/snoop/releases
Список изменений:
-
Расширена поисковая web-base Snoop ↑ 3700+ сайтов.
-
Ускорен поиск в Snoop for GNU/Linux ~ на 140% т.е. почти в 2.5 раза! (при скорости интернет соединения не менее 12 Мбит/с поиск ‘username’, используя БД Snoop full версии, в quick-режиме ‘–quick/-q’ длится менее 1-й минуты).
-
Ускорен запуск Snoop Project build version на старых ПК с OS Windows/HDD.
-
Добавлен новый и умный алгоритм автоопределения явно не указанных/проблемных/перепутанных кодировок сайтов при поиске в различных режимах.
-
Добавлено больше информативности в CLI при поиске по сокращенной БД, используя опции фильтры: ‘–site/–exclude/–include’ (кол-во веб сайтов при сужении поиска отображается в квадратных скобках справа от общего кол-ва сайтов БД).
-
Изменен порог оповещения о Bad_raw: поднят c 2% до 2.5%.
-
Форматирование. Улучшено стилизирование инфострок в CLI на небольших/сжатых по размеру терминалах, например, в CLI Termux на Android (добавлены авто отступы строк с учетом пользовательского CLI-окружения). Переработан внешний вид премиальных предложений, которые действуют для всех пользователей Snoop full version.
-
Обновлен HTML-отчёт:
- изменены стили кнопок;
- добавлена подсветка, увеличение строки из списка websites при наведении курсора, двигаясь по списку при выборе ресурса сложно теперь промахнуться;
- удалена дублирующая строка/тавтология о том, на скольких ресурсах найден ‘username’;
- в Snoop demo version добавлена парочка упоминаний об использовании demo версий/просьба о пожертвовании на развитие проекта/full;
- увеличена визуальная составляющая группировки флагов стран;
- добавлено отображение title(s) саундтреков при наведении на них курсора.
-
Исправлено автотестирование сети в режиме вербализации ‘–verbose/-v’ в случае, когда тесты иногда проваливались из-за отказа некоторых серверов принимать соединение по незащищенному каналу.
-
Во всех версиях Snoop убран звук из CLI (звуковые оповещения об ошибках и об окончании поиска).
-
К Snoop full version добавлены light сборки, позволяющие запукать ПО почти мгновенно.
-
Android. Немного ускорен поиск в режиме вербализации.
-
Android. Если пользователь предпочитает открывать html-отчеты вручную и из своего GUI ФМ, то теперь подтягиваются и все стили.
-
Обновлены плагины ‘GEO_IP/domain’ и ‘ReverseVgeocoder’ до новых версий. Расширена визуализация данных в html-отчетах в Snoop full версиях, в частности добавлены:
- чекбокс фильтрации данных по странам;
- графики со статистикой по странам, регионам, объектам, провайдерам;
- новый слой — топокарты, меняется по клику/свайпу;
- режим переключения в полный экран;
- авто отображение координат в любой точке на карте;
- масштаб линейки;
- памятка, отображающая статистику по InvalidData;
- copyright;
- поиск;
- в плагине ‘ReverseVgeocoder’ увеличен масштаб покрытия/точности от 10-100 раз по округам/объектам в RU; EU и CIS локациях.
Внимание! Для того, чтобы воспользоваться всеми обновлениями, если ранее пользователь уже пользовался старыми сборками Snoop, нужно сбросить кэш (разовая операция):
snoop_cli --autoclean
если пользователь предпочитал использовать Snoop в исходной форме, обновить библиотеки:
cd ~/snoop && python3 -m pip install -r requirements_android.txt #Android
;
cd ~/snoop && python3 -m pip install -r requirements.txt #Desktop
>>> Подробности